Understanding the Mechanics of the Crash Game

At its heart, the crash game is remarkably straightforward. A player initiates a round by placing a bet. A multiplier begins at 1x and progressively increases. The player’s goal is to cash out their bet before the multiplier 'crashes' – that is, reaches a random point and ends the round. If the player cashes out before the crash, they win their initial bet multiplied by the current multiplier. If the multiplier crashes before the player cashes out, they lose their initial bet. The simplicity of this mechanism is precisely what makes it so appealing, as even novice casino players can quickly grasp the rules. However, mastering the game requires more than just understanding the basics; it requires developing a sound strategy.

The timing of the cash out is the crucial element. Players are often faced with the dilemma of taking a smaller, guaranteed profit or risking it all for a potentially larger payout. Longer you wait, the higher the multiplier climbs, and the greater the potential reward. However, the longer you wait, the higher the risk of a crash. Psychological factors play a significant role here. Many players find themselves hesitant to cash out, hoping for an even higher multiplier, often leading to costly mistakes. Understanding your own risk aversion and setting realistic goals is essential for consistent success. Effective bankroll management is also paramount. Only betting a small percentage of your total bankroll on each round helps mitigate the impact of losing streaks.

Volatility and Random Number Generators

The randomness of the crash point is determined by a Random Number Generator (RNG). A trustworthy online casino will utilize a certified RNG, ensuring fairness and impartiality. It’s important to choose platforms that are licensed and regulated by reputable authorities, as these certifications ensure the RNG is independently audited and verified. Understanding the volatility of the game is also important. While each round is independent, some platforms may have an underlying payout distribution that influences the frequency of crashes. Observing gameplay patterns (though past performance is no guarantee of future results) can offer insights into the game’s volatility. Remember, the game is designed to have a house edge, meaning that over the long run, the casino is expected to profit. Your goal as a player is to maximize your short-term gains while minimizing your losses.

The inherent nature of the RNG introduces an element of unpredictability that cannot be completely overcome. Strategies can improve your odds, but they cannot eliminate risk. Trying to predict the exact crash point is futile; the focus should instead be on managing risk and setting realistic profit targets. Some players employ strategies like auto-cashout features, which allow them to set a specific multiplier at which their bet will automatically be cashed out, eliminating the emotional element of decision-making. However, even with auto-cashout, it’s crucial to understand the potential for variance and to adjust your settings accordingly.

Strategies for Playing Crash Games

A multitude of strategies have emerged within the crash game community, each promising to increase a player’s chances of success. One common approach is the Martingale system, where players double their bet after each loss, aiming to recoup previous losses with a single win. While this strategy can be effective in the short term, it requires a substantial bankroll and carries a significant risk of depleting funds during prolonged losing streaks. Another strategy is the anti-Martingale system, where players increase their bet after each win and decrease it after each loss. This approach is less risky than the Martingale system but may result in slower overall profits.

More nuanced strategies involve analyzing previous crash data (although, as mentioned earlier, past performance is not indicative of future results) to identify potential patterns. Some players look for clusters of crashes at certain multiplier ranges, while others track the average crash point over extended periods. However, it's vital to remember that the RNG is designed to be unpredictable, and any perceived patterns may simply be due to chance. Ultimately, the most effective strategy often involves a combination of these techniques, tailored to the individual player’s risk tolerance, bankroll, and playing style. Consistency and discipline are key; sticking to a pre-determined strategy and avoiding impulsive decisions can significantly improve your odds of success.

Managing Emotions and Avoiding Tilt

“Tilt” is a term commonly used in gambling to describe a state of emotional frustration or desperation that leads to impulsive and irrational decision-making. When on tilt, players often abandon their pre-determined strategies and start making reckless bets in an attempt to quickly recover their losses. This is a recipe for disaster, as it typically results in even greater losses. Learning to recognize the signs of tilt is essential for maintaining control. These signs can include increased heart rate, sweating, irritability, and a loss of focus.
